Rahuthara

Rahuthara is a village located in Bhogaon tehsil of Mainpuri district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Bhogaon (tehsildar office) and 38km away from district headquarter Mainpuri. As per 2009 stats, Madhukarpur is the gram panchayat of Rahuthara village.

About Rahuthara

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Rahuthara is 126871. The village spans a total geographical area of 157.76 hectares. Bhogaon is nearest town to Rahuthara village for all major economic activities.

Population of Rahuthara

Below is a concise population overview of Rahuthara as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 928 524 404
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 166 97 69
Scheduled Castes (SC) 20 11 9
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 585 373 212
Illiterate Population 343 151 192

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Rahuthara village:

  • The total population of Rahuthara village is around 928, including approximately 524 males and 404 females, with a sex ratio of 770 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 166 children aged 0–6 years in Rahuthara village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Rahuthara village has 20 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Rahuthara village is about 63.04%, with male literacy at 71.18% and female literacy at 52.48%.
  • There are around 139 households in Rahuthara village.

Connectivity of Rahuthara

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Rahuthara. As per the 2011 stats, Rahuthara had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available
Private Bus Service Available
Railway Station Available
